Key Responsibilities
- Supporting the planning, coordination, implementation, and monitoring of construction and maintenance projects.
- Assisting with site inspections, progress monitoring, measurements, and project assessments to ensure activities are completed according to plans and specifications.
- Supporting project costing, budgeting, procurement, tender preparation, and contract administration processes.
- Monitoring project expenditures, supplier and contractor performance, and maintaining accurate project records and documentation.
- Preparing project reports, payment documentation, progress updates, and other administrative and technical documentation
- Coordinating stakeholder engagements, project meetings, and communication with clients, consultants, suppliers, and contractors.
- Providing general project management, operational, monitoring, reporting, and administrative support to the Production Unit.
Requirements
- Bachelor’s Degree, National Diploma, or equivalent qualification in Quantity Surveying, Construction Management, Civil Engineering, or a related field. Project Management is an added advantage
- Basic knowledge of project management principles, construction processes, cost estimation, procurement, and contract administration.
- Ability to read and interpret construction drawings, specifications, and project documentation.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ications, particularly Word and Excel.
- Good anal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ills.
- Ability to manage multiple tasks and meet deadlines.
- Willingness to learn and develop professionally.
- Ability to work both independently and as part of a team.

Frequently Asked Questions
What qualifications are typically required for a Quantity Surveying Graduate Intern position in Namibia?
You would generally need a Bachelor's degree in Quantity Surveying or Construction Management from a recognised institution, such as NUST or UNAM. Practical experience through vacation work or a strong academic record demonstrating analytical skills and attention to detail are also highly valued.
What would be the common day-to-day responsibilities of a Quantity Surveying Graduate Intern?
As an intern, you would assist senior Quantity Surveyors with tasks such as taking off quantities, preparing bills of quantities, cost estimation, and contract administration support. You'd also learn to review tender documents, conduct site visits for progress assessment, and contribute to cost control measures on various construction projects.
What is the typical work culture and expectations for an intern in the Namibian construction sector?
The Namibian construction sector values professionalism, a strong work ethic, and a willingness to learn from experienced professionals. Interns are expected to be proactive, ask questions, demonstrate initiative, and integrate well into established project teams.
What realistic career progression paths can I expect after completing a Quantity Surveying Graduate Internship in Namibia?
Successful completion often leads to opportunities for a junior Quantity Surveyor role or similar entry-level positions within construction firms or consulting practices. You would then work towards gaining sufficient experience and professional registration with relevant Namibian bodies to advance your career.
What typical benefits can a Quantity Surveying Graduate Intern expect during their internship?
Interns typically receive a monthly stipend to cover living expenses, as full-time employee benefits like comprehensive medical aid or pension are less common for short-term internships. Some internships may offer limited paid leave or allowances for work-related travel, depending on the specific program.
How should I best prepare my application, and what do Namibian employers typically look for in a Quantity Surveying Graduate Intern?
Focus on a well-structured CV highlighting your academic achievements, relevant projects, and any practical exposure. Employers in Namibia seek candidates who are eager to learn, possess strong analytical skills, and demonstrate a keen interest in the construction industry and its local context.
